The Shrimpers Trust Player of the Year Awards will be held on the 12th May in the Shrimpers Bar.

Proceedings will start promptly at 8 but we strongly advise you arrive early.

Along with the POTY Awards there will be the Goal of the Season (sponsored by SZ), the SJS Player of the Year, Top Travellers and a few other 'Special' Presentations.

Also Kevin Feasey's Season Review is a must see.

Entrance is free to all Trust Members and  £1.00 for non members.
Non Members can join on the night and gain all the benefits of Trust Membership.
